You might have heard a lot about Google's big efforts in Artificial Intelligence. They have incredibly clever people and seemingly endless money. So, it's a bit surprising when an AI expert openly wonders why Google's AI chatbot, often called a Large Language Model (LLM) – that's a fancy term for the computer program that powers conversations like ChatGPT – isn't always living up to expectations.

This particular expert decided to 'interview' Google's own AI about its performance. And the results were surprisingly candid. The AI itself seemed to acknowledge some of its limitations, pointing to things like its training data and how it's designed. It's a bit like asking a new apprentice how they're going, and they admit they're still learning the ropes.

What does this mean for everyday Aussies? Well, it highlights an important point: not all AI is created equal. While some AI tools like ChatGPT or Microsoft's Copilot are making big headlines, other major players are still finding their footing. It shows that even with massive resources, building truly intelligent and reliable AI is incredibly complex and takes time.

For small business owners, this story is a useful reminder to be savvy consumers. Don't just jump on the first AI tool you hear about. Do your homework. Look for tools that are genuinely helpful and robust, rather than just the latest buzz. It also tells us that even the biggest tech companies are still on a journey with AI, and what's available today might be very different in a few months or a year. Patience and careful evaluation are key.
